A friend of ours, Cheryl Beck is launching her new charity Tea Party Angels this weekend with a great kickoff party in NYC, featuring Christie Brinkley and her daughter Sailor. Tea Party Angels is a new fund-raising concept to encourage girls to raise money to help other girls around the globe. The concept is simple – a girl (perhaps your daughter) decides to host a tea party – either at home or a participating tea shop. Instead of presents, the girl asks for donations to a cause to help ease poverty, hunger or help a girl in a developing nation go to school. Parents help by coming up with a chore a task their daughter can do to make the donation money. The collected money can be sent back to Tea Party Angels which will distribute it a network of organizations that support girl empowerment.
Then at the party, the girls and moms get together, watch a video, donate money, have a good time and help another girl. Tea Party Angels provides complete tea party kits and the parties can be hosted at home or a tea shop. We think it’s a great new idea for birthday parties or just because…
The kit comes with activities (like t-shirt making and quizzes) as well as the educational video plus step by step instructions on hosting the party.
